Any service for compensation involving the application of psychological principles for ...Applicants for commercial driver licenses must meet both state and federal vision requirements. The minimum requirements are: Binocular vision. Visual acuity (Snellen) of at least 20/40 or better in each eye. A field of vision of at least 70 degrees in each eye. The ability to distinguish between red, green and amber colors. National examination. The Maryland State Board Examination is a jurisprudence exam. To take this exam, the candidate shall read and comprehend the laws and regulations governing the practice of veterinary medicine in the State of Maryland. Only after this has been completed may the candidate sign a statement attesting to this fact before a Notary Public.Is the Maryland jurisprudence Exam open book? An applicant must receive a passing score of 75% or better to be eligible for massage licensure or registration. If you are unsuccessful in passing the Examination after two attempts, the re-take fee will be $250.00, and a new examination registration form must be submitted to the Board with payment of the re-take fee.
